The UK has among the toughest regulatory environments anywhere. The U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) defines the benchmark for player safety. Its rules encompass everything from preventing money laundering to the exact language used in bonus offers. For a casino to operate for UK residents legally, it must have a valid UKGC license. There are no exceptions. When I check a casino’s standing for the UK market, confirming this specific license is invariably my first move. The casino might possess other international licenses. While that can indicate a broader regulatory approach, it does not substitute for the direct accountability and consumer rights required under UK law.
Contrast with UK-Regulated Casino Standards

To truly understand Jet4Bet’s standing, it is beneficial to measure it with what a UK-licensed casino must provide. The UK Gambling Commission’s license terms are detailed and centered on the player. They impose strict rules on age verification, which must happen before any play. They govern advertising transparency. They mandate the separation of player funds from the company’s operational money, which secures player balances if the business fails. They also mandate a link to the national GamStop self-exclusion scheme. The financial penalties for breaking these rules are substantial, often amounting to millions of pounds. This creates a strong incentive for casinos to comply.
The list below displays some of the key safeguards a UK player receives automatically with a UKGC-licensed casino. These are not guaranteed under other licenses like Curacao’s.
- Funds Protection: Customer money must be kept separate. Operators often must specify the level of protection and the procedure if they go bankrupt.
- GamStop Integration: Casinos are required to join the GamStop scheme. One registration prevents access to a player from all UK-licensed gambling sites.
- Advertising Rules: Strict controls on bonus ads. Prohibitions on misleading « free bet » claims and rules that key terms must be clear.
- Dedicated ADR: Access to a no-cost, independent Alternative Dispute Resolution service selected by the UKGC.
- Affordability Assessments: Operators must monitor for signs of financial harm and step in. This goes beyond the limits a player chooses for themselves.
In my review, the absence of these specific, robust safeguards under a non-UK license is a substantial gap. For someone living in the UK, the security and regulatory framework delivered by a UKGC-licensed casino is essentially more comprehensive and more enforceable. This isn’t about if the games are fun or the customer service is courteous. It’s about the real safety nets built into the system to shield you.
Jet4Bet Casino’s Regulatory Status for UK Players
My look into Jet4Bet Casino’s licensing reveals one crucial fact. Jet4Bet does not have a license from the United Kingdom Gambling Commission. This point alters everything. The casino’s main website states it is licensed by the Government of Curacao. A Curacao eGaming license is standard for international operators and does set some basic rules. But its level of player protection, its oversight, and its enforcement cannot match the UKGC’s system. Because of this, Jet4Bet Casino is not allowed to promote to or provide services for customers living in Great Britain.
This forms a firm boundary for UK-based players. If you try to register or log in from a UK internet address, the site’s geo-blocking will probably prevent you. You’ll likely be redirected or see a message saying services are not available in your region. This is a normal step for casinos lacking a UK license. From a security standpoint, this geo-blocking is actually a safeguarding feature. It stops UK players from accidentally using a platform that isn’t regulated by their home authority. So, while Jet4Bet may be a legitimate business in other places, its operational area clearly does not include the United Kingdom. For UK players, any mention of using its services is mostly theoretical.

Transparency and Management of Disputes
How transparent a casino is regarding its operations reveals a lot about its reputation. Openness involves having unambiguous, easy-to-find terms and conditions, particularly for bonuses. It also entails having a simple way to make a complaint and have it resolved. I always read the bonus terms carefully. I look for equitable wagering requirements and definite rules on which games are eligible. Vague or excessively restrictive terms are a major cause for concern. Equally important is a impartial complaints process. Players need to know clearly how to reach support for a dispute and what to do if they are dissatisfied with the first answer.
For casinos regulated by the UKGC, there is a defined escalation path. The player can submit their complaint to the regulator’s authorized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R) provider. This impartial service adjudicates disputes between the player and the operator. Because Jet4Bet doesn’t have a UKGC license, UK players are not able to use this particular, effective option. They would have to rely on the process managed by the Curacao licensing authority. This highlights a key difference between regulatory systems. A open casino will describe its complaint process openly. Features like a specific email for complaints, a live chat function, and a disclosed timeline for addressing disputes all foster a open and safe environment.

Equitable Gaming and Random Number Generator Certification
Protection isn’t just about safeguarding data. It’s also about guaranteeing that games are fair. This is where Random Number Generator (RNG) certification becomes essential. An RNG is a complex algorithm that decides the random result of every slot spin, every card dealt, every dice roll. To ensure these outcomes are genuinely random and not manipulated, independent testing agencies audit the RNG software. Agencies like iTech Labs, eCOGRA, or Gaming Laboratories International (GLI) provide this certification. Part of my assessment involves checking the casino’s site for seals or reports from these testers. A certified RNG gives mathematical proof that every player has the same chance to win. That fairness is the foundation of a trustworthy gaming experience.
Account Security and Player Verification (KYC)
Maintaining an account secure is a job shared by the casino and the player. Jet4Bet, complying with standard practice and anti-money laundering (AML) rules, conducts a Know Your Customer (KYC) process. This implies players must validate their identity and address. They do this by submitting documents like a passport, driver’s license, or a recent utility bill. Some players consider this step annoying. I see it as a crucial security measure. It blocks fraudulent account creation, helps prevent identity theft, and curbs underage gambling. It also locks down the player’s account, ensuring withdrawals only go to the verified owner. Employing a strong, unique password and enabling two-factor authentication (2FA) if it’s available are extra steps players should always take.
